Basement Flooding Threats That Could Exist

Numerous factors could endanger your basement and raise your risk of flooding. Poor lot grading, neglected foundations, and pipe problems are among the most typical dangers to houses and businesses with basements. Sump pump failure, sewer backup, weeping tile problems, and weather-related occurrences like heavy downpours are some more possible dangers.

Tips for Handling Flood Damage

Water damage from flooding or even a simple leaky faucet can be disastrous and put your loved ones’ health in danger. Additionally, it can harm the building’s elements, and in rare situations, the entire construction.

Ignoring the water damage and/or treating it incorrectly might result in expensive repairs, replacements, and the resulting mental trauma. Mold growth brought on by water damage might also result in health problems.

You have the chance to lessen the damage if your home floods as a result of a plumbing system error. The water source should be turned off as soon as you can. Turn off the water supply to the entire house if necessary. After that, get rid of as much of the standing water as you can. Cover any exposed skin if there are any pollutants.

Mold Prevention in Water Damage Repair

Mold growth is one of the most significant risks that come with water damage. After a flood or any water-related issue, mold can begin to develop within 24-48 hours if the affected areas are not properly cleaned and dried.

Mold thrives in damp environments, especially when water is absorbed into porous materials such as wood, drywall, and carpets. Therefore, mold prevention must be a top priority during water damage restoration. To prevent mold growth, water damage repair must be swift and thorough. The first step is to remove standing water immediately. This can be done using industrial-grade water extractors, vacuums, and pumps.

Once the majority of the water is removed, the next step involves drying the area. This requires the use of heavy-duty fans, industrial dehumidifiers, and heaters to reduce the moisture levels to safe thresholds. Without proper drying, even seemingly minor amounts of water can contribute to mold formation.

Once the area is completely dried, a mold inhibitor should be applied to the affected surfaces. These agents are designed to kill mold spores that might still be present and prevent new growth.

Additionally, professional restoration services use specialized cleaning agents that not only remove the visible signs of mold but also address any hidden mold growth that could be harmful over time. Mold can cause significant damage to a home’s structure and also pose health risks, so it is vital to address it quickly and efficiently.

Preventing mold is about more than just removing water. It’s about controlling the environment and ensuring that it is conducive to long-term drying. Importance of Fast Water Damage Restoration

The importance of fast water damage restoration cannot be overstated. When water damage occurs—whether from a burst pipe, heavy rainfall, or a flooding event—it’s crucial to act quickly. Water spreads rapidly through the affected area, penetrating walls, floors, and furniture. The longer the water sits, the more extensive the damage becomes, leading to more expensive repairs and longer recovery times.

One of the most significant reasons for fast water damage restoration is the prevention of structural damage. Water can weaken structural materials, such as wood and drywall, compromising the integrity of your home. If left untreated, wood can warp, drywall can sag or collapse, and even the foundation of your home may become unstable. These problems only worsen as time passes, making immediate restoration essential for minimizing long-term damage.

Moreover, fast restoration is crucial for minimizing mold growth. As mentioned earlier, mold can begin to form as soon as 24-48 hours after water exposure. Mold is not only damaging to your property but can also cause significant health issues for your family, such as respiratory problems, allergies, and infections. Quick water extraction and drying help prevent these harmful consequences and reduce the risk of mold growth.

Another key aspect of fast restoration is the reduction of secondary water damage. This includes damage to furniture, appliances, and personal belongings. Upholstered furniture, electronics, and clothing can all absorb water, leading to stains, corrosion, or complete ruin. Quick restoration efforts can salvage these items, saving you money and sentimental value.
